Still from 'Wasteminster' Animation
Wasteminster is the launch film for Greenpeace's 2021 campaign against the UK's waste exports to other countries. Voiced by impressionists Matt Forde and Jon Culshaw, the film features Boris Johnson being engulfed in a wave of plastic while giving a speech in Downing Street. Producers Park Village and Studio Birthplace used a bespoke VFX simulation to create the dynamic flow of 1.8 million kilos of plastic - the amount of waste the UK exports to other countries every day.

Stills from "Wasteminster" Animation
Stills of "Wasteminster", an animation for Greenpeace UK by Studio Birthplace which reveals the government's hypocrisy when it comes to the UK's plastic waste. Despite Prime Minister Boris Johnson's claims that the UK is a global leader in tackling pollution, the majority of UK waste ends up dumped and burned in far flung countries that don't have the capacity to deal with it.
The voiceover features impressionists Matt Forde as Boris Johnson and Jon Culshaw as Michael Gove.
